Back to School Stress in Teenagers is Topic of Discussion

The GHS Outreach Club, along with the GHS CODA (Co-Occurring Disorders Awareness) Club, the GHS StressLess Club, the Harris Project and Arch Street Teen Center, have organized a community event entitled “Stress, Success and Teenage Setbacks, Let’s Talk Back to School Stress,” for Monday, Oct. 1 from 7 to 8 p.m.

The program will feature Keynote Speaker, Stephanie Marquesano, Founder of the Harris Project, who will share her story and help parents and teens learn how to recognize warning signs of mental health challenges, what to say to a friend/parent, and where to go for help.

The event will take place at Arch Street, the Greenwich Teen Center.
